Sawai Jai Singh ll Tomb
Immerse yourself in the serene grandeur of Sawai Jai Singh II Tomb, nestled in the historic quarters of Jaipur, Rajasthan. Bathed in warm sunlight, this majestic marble mausoleum enchants with its elegantly carved domes and intricate pillars, inviting travel lovers to step back in time and feel the soulful spirit of India’s royal past. Perfect for history buffs and culture seekers, the site evokes awe and tranquility amid its peaceful courtyards, blending architectural beauty with a quiet, contemplative atmosphere.
